Satellite 1400 enters standby after 30 minutes when it is not in use

Hey all.

I just installed a module of 256 MB of RAM, so I now 384 of RAM. He moved, the computer between stand-by mode after about 30 minutes when it is not being used. I tried to change the power management settings, but when I click on power management in the Toshiba console, nothing happens! Even when I use the power management of the Panel (in windows XP), it tells me to use the Toshiba console! Help! How can I change the time before the computer between the stand mode?

See you soon

Hello

First of all if the Toshiba power saver is installed on the laptop so the electric windows options doesn t work.
All power settings should be changed or set the energy saver.
You must choose the energy saving mode, and then click Details
You should see 3 tabs.
Check the second power saver tab you can change some settings, also the stand by time. After this procedure, you must apply the change.
Also check the 3rd mode of the system power tab

    I'm (unfortunately) using windows 8.

    To use an old sessionstore instead of the current file, first of all, close Firefox. Rename sessionstore.js sessionstore.old file, and then rename the sessionstore.bak -datetime sessionstore.js file. When you start Firefox, if it is set to restore the tabs and windows of the previous session should only pick up. If it is set to start with your home page, use history > restore previous Session.
